Dynamic Column Reference in Sum.List

This first formula works, but I am trying to remove the hard column reference ([FY24 Original Baseline]) to a dynamic reference from a varible:

 

List.Sum(Table.SelectRows(tbl_DSBaselines,

(InnerTable) => InnerTable[FinancialID] = [FinancialID] and

InnerTable[Baseline Version] = Text.Combine({FiscalYear,"Q0"}))[FY24 Original Baseline]

)

 

Does not work (returns a List) and I cannot figure out the correct syntax to accomplish this. Table.Column is clearly not correct.

 

FiscalYearBaseline is the variable containing the column name I want to reference.

 

List.Sum(Table.SelectRows(tbl_DSBaselines,

(InnerTable) => InnerTable[FinancialID] = [FinancialID] and

InnerTable[Baseline Version] = Text.Combine({FiscalYear,"Q0"})){Table.Column(tbl_DSBaselines,FiscalYearBaseline)}

)

1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ION
jgordon11
Resolver II
Resolver II

List.Sum(Table.Column(Table.SelectRows(tbl_DSBaselines, (InnerTable) => InnerTable[FinancialID] = [FinancialID] and InnerTable[Baseline Version] = Text.Combine({FiscalYear,"Q0"})), FiscalYearBaseline))
